Transaction 21dc43e9a73eac6b47ec81488acbdec70f70c88ad0f7a68451949e9e749e5142
1 Input
1 Output
-
21dc43e9a73eac6b47ec81488acbdec70f70c88ad0f7a68451949e9e749e5142:0
- value
- 1228967
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0395273115017ea34afe115ae86b582bd34c4ed9 OP_EQUAL
- address
- 321xdTWK9356CSb2jXEP53jf76yWG4txUJ